U.S. Virgin Islander vs Immigrants from Canada In Labor Force | Age 35-44 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 87,507,209 people shows a weak positive correlation between the proportion of U.S. Virgin Islanders and labor force participation rate among population between the ages 35 and 44 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.295 and weighted average of 84.0%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 459,143,977 people shows a poor neg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Canada and labor force participation rate among population between the ages 35 and 44 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.117 and weighted average of 84.2%, a difference of 0.22%.
